1. Install "ngspice" package

This guide covers the steps necessary to install ngspice on Ubuntu 16.04 LTS (Xenial Xerus)

$ sudo apt update $ sudo apt install ngspice

2. Uninstall "ngspice" package

This guide let you learn how to uninstall ngspice on Ubuntu 16.04 LTS (Xenial Xerus):

$ sudo apt remove ngspice $ sudo apt autoclean && sudo apt autoremove

Description-en: Spice circuit simulator
NGspice is a mixed-level/mixed-signal circuit simulator.
Its code is based on three open source software packages:
Spice3f5, Cider1b1 and Xspice.
.
NGspice is part of gEDA project, a full GPL'd suite of
Electronic Design Automation tools.
